Jonathan Rea claimed second spot behind commanding winner Alvaro Bautista in the first race of the Catalunya World Superbikes round.

Bautista led throughout to clinch his ninth chequered flag of the season. It also extended his championship lead to 44 points.

Rea was as far back as seventh in the early exchanges, but he battled well to finish runner-up.

Defending champion Toprak Razgatlioglu could only manage fifth.

The Superpole sprint race takes place at 10 o'clock on Sunday morning, followed by race two at one o'clock.
